A tactical pen with a glass breaker serves as a versatile tool for personal safety, combining practical writing capabilities with an emergency defense mechanism. These pens feature a concealed glass breaker tip that can shatter tempered glass, enabling users to escape from vehicles or confined spaces in critical situations. Constructed from durable materials like stainless steel or aircraft-grade aluminum, they are designed for both long-term use and impact resistance. The precision-engineered glass breaker is effective without compromising the pen's functionality as a writing instrument. When selecting one, prioritize quality of materials, ergonomic design for a secure grip, and ease of maintenance to ensure it remains durable and functional. Regular training is essential to effectively use the pen in self-defense scenarios, and it should come with additional features such as a pocket clip, lanyard hole, or an integrated LED light for versatility. The best tactical pens offer seamless integration of these components, making them indispensable for everyday carry (EDC) and emergency preparedness. Remember to choose one that aligns with your writing preferences and offers superior ink performance for daily tasks.

Choosing the Right Tactical Pen for You: Factors to Consider

When selecting a tactical pen, the primary consideration should be its suitability for your specific needs and environment. A key feature to look for in a tactical pen is the inclusion of a glass breaker tip. This can be an invaluable tool in emergency situations where breaking a window may be necessary for self-defense or to signal for help. The durability and strength of the glass breaker are paramount; it should be made from a hardened material capable of shattering tempered glass without compromising the pen’s structural integrity. Additionally, the glass breaker should not impede the pen’s functionality as a writing instrument, ensuring that it writes smoothly and without discomfort.

Beyond the glass breaker feature, consider the build quality and materials of the tactical pen. A high-quality aluminum or titanium body not only provides a premium feel but also offers robustness and resistance to environmental factors. The weight and ergonomics are also crucial; a well-balanced pen that fits comfortably in your hand can enhance your writing experience and serve as a more effective self-defense tool if needed. Furthermore, inspect the pen’s mechanism for deploying and retracting the point; it should be reliable and easy to operate with one hand. Lastly, ensure the ink cartridge or refill is of high quality and matches your preference for writing smoothness and longevity. By carefully considering these factors, you can choose a tactical pen that effectively meets both your everyday writing needs and your tactical requirements.
